#zumen_box {
	width:735px;
	margin-bottom:80px;
}
#zumen_box ul {
	width: 720px;
	margin-top: 0px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 20px;
	padding: 0px;
}
#zumen_box li {
	width: 70px;
	margin-left: 5px;
	margin-right: 5px;
	margin-bottom: 10px;
	float: left;
	list-style-type: none;
}
#zumen_box .main {
	width: 700px;
	height: 520px;
	margin-left: auto;
	margin-right: auto;
	padding: 10px;
	/*border: 1px solid #979797;*/
	position: relative;
	margin-bottom: 35px;
}
#zumen_box .main .gallery-img {
	position:absolute;
	top:0;
	left:0;
	padding:10px;
}

#zumen_box .main p {
	color:#FFFFFF;
	font-size:16px;
	padding-left:10px;
	padding-top:5px;
	padding-bottom:5px;
}
#zumen_box .main p.name1 {
	background-color:#ff7800;
}
#zumen_box .main p.name2 {
	background-color:#7ca96f;
}
#zumen_box .main p.name3 {
	background-color:#8683b2;
}
.gallery_link {
	text-align:right;
	margin-top: 10px;
	margin-bottom: 15px;
	font-size: 15px;
	/*background-image: url(../zumen_img/icon3.gif);
	background-position: left 7px;
	background-repeat: no-repeat;*/
}
.gallery_link img.icon3 {
	padding-bottom:8px;
	margin-right:5px;
}
.gallery_link a {
	color: #D50003;
}
.gallery_link a:hover {
	color:#FF6600;
}

.gallery_link2 {
	padding-left: 18px;
	margin-top:45px;
	margin-left:20px;
	font-size: 14px;
	background-image: url(../zumen_img/icon3.gif);
	background-position: left 4px;
	background-repeat: no-repeat;
	width:250px;
}

/*施行例用1*/

#seko_box735 {
	width:735px;
	margin-bottom:80px;
}
#seko_box735 ul {
	width: 720px;
	margin-top: 0px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 20px;
	padding: 0px;
}
#seko_box735 li {
	width: 75px;
	margin-left: 7px;
	margin-right: 7px;
	margin-bottom: 10px;
	float: left;
	list-style-type: none;
}
#seko_box735 .main {
	width: 700px;
	height: 490px;
	margin-left: auto;
	margin-right: auto;
	padding: 10px;
	border: 1px solid #979797;
	position: relative;
	margin-bottom: 35px;
}
#seko_box735 .main .gallery-img {
	position:absolute;
	top:0;
	left:0;
	padding:10px;
}


/*施行例用1 コメント付き*/

#seko_box735c {
	width:735px;
	margin-bottom:80px;
}
#seko_box735c ul {
	width: 720px;
	margin-top: 0px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 20px;
	padding: 0px;
}
#seko_box735c li {
	width: 75px;
	margin-left: 7px;
	margin-right: 7px;
	margin-bottom: 10px;
	float: left;
	list-style-type: none;
}
#seko_box735c .main {
	width: 700px;
	height: 400px;
	margin-left: auto;
	margin-right: auto;
	padding: 10px;
	border: 1px solid #979797;
	position: relative;
	margin-bottom: 35px;
}
#seko_box735c .main .gallery-img {
	position:absolute;
	top:0;
	left:0;
	padding:10px;
}
#seko_box735c .main .gallery-img img {
	float:left;
}



/*規格図面用1*/
#kikaku_box735 {
	width:735px;
	margin-bottom:80px;
}
#kikaku_box735 ul {
	width: 720px;
	margin-top: 0px;
	margin-left: auto;
	margin-right: auto;
	margin-bottom: 20px;
	padding: 0px;
}
#kikaku_box735 li {
	width: 75px;
	margin-left: 7px;
	margin-right: 7px;
	margin-bottom: 10px;
	float: left;
	list-style-type: none;
}
#kikaku_box735 .main {
	width: 600px;
	height: 540px;
	margin-left: auto;
	margin-right: auto;
	padding: 10px;
	border: 1px solid #979797;
	position: relative;
	margin-bottom: 35px;
}
#kikaku_box735 .main .gallery-img {
	position:absolute;
	top:0;
	left:0;
	padding:10px;
}
